    Transform your garden into a vibrant haven with the magnificent Clematis Polish Spirit live vine. Known as the “Queen of Vines,” Clematis offers an unparalleled display of blooms, and ‘Polish Spirit’ is no exception. This particular variety, Clematis viticella ‘Polish Spirit’, is celebrated for its masses of rich purple-blue flowers that grace the landscape from July through September, extending the beauty of your garden well into autumn. Unlike some other clematis varieties, the Clematis Polish Spirit live vine is highly valued for its robust health and resistance to wilt disease, making it a reliable and rewarding choice for both novice and experienced gardeners. Whether adorning a mailbox, trellis, or porch, this free-flowering vine creates a spectacular cascade of color, making it an essential addition to any outdoor space.

    The ‘Polish Spirit’ Clematis received the prestigious Royal Horticultural Society Award of Garden Merit in England, a testament to its outstanding performance and ornamental value. It’s an easy-to-grow plant that thrives in a variety of settings, providing a stunning visual impact with its 3-inch wide blooms.     Plant Care & Growing Tips

    To ensure your Clematis Polish Spirit live vine thrives and produces an abundance of its stunning purple-blue flowers, understanding its specific care requirements is crucial. This variety is known for being relatively easy to grow, making viticella clematis care manageable for most gardeners. The old saying for clematis holds true: “Tops in the sun and feet in the shade.” This means the vine blooms best with its foliage and flowers exposed to full sun (at least 6 hours of direct sunlight daily), while its roots prefer cool, shaded conditions. You can achieve this by planting small groundcovers like ivy, myrtle, or pachysandra around the base of the plant, or by placing a stone or tile to provide shade for the root zone.

    The ‘Polish Spirit’ Clematis thrives in fertile, humus-rich, and well-drained soil. Good drainage is paramount to prevent root rot. Before planting, amend the soil with composted manure or a good quality compost to improve fertility and structure. Water regularly, especially during dry spells, to keep the soil consistently moist but not waterlogged. Mulching around the base of the plant will help retain soil moisture and keep the roots cool. During the growing season (spring through summer), feed your clematis once a month with a balanced fertilizer to encourage vigorous growth and prolific blooming. This plant is hardy in USDA Zones 4-8, making it suitable for a wide range of climates. Pruning is simple for this Type 3 clematis (which blooms on new wood): in late winter or early spring, prune all stems back to about 12-18 inches from the ground to encourage strong new growth and abundant flowers. Following these clematis growing tips will result in a spectacular display of blooms.
